LG News Hub
If you use an LG smart device, you’ll be pleased to learn the new LG News Hub has been added to the channel options. If you’ve cut the cord or your cable box is collecting dust, this is a FAST (free ad-supported TV) channel that will pick up local and national news from ABC News Live, CNN Headlines, NBC News NOW, Scripps News, and other sources.
Local news will cover Austin, Texas; Washington, DC; Salt Lake City, Utah; Cincinnati, Ohio; Las Vegas, Nevada; Baltimore, Maryland; and Seattle, Washington.
If you’re wondering who asked for yet another way to aggregate the news, LG says they’ve tracked a 66% increase in unique devices accessing news feeds from LG devices. There is no word on whether other television manufacturers have seen similar spikes or if LG users are particularly engaged.
